Life in Hamilton County & Beyond

Hamilton County shares many of the great qualities that make Tennessee a desirable place to live.

Tennessee is known for its dazzling natural beauty, rich history, and vibrant culture. With its rolling hills, majestic mountains, and sparkling waterways, Tennessee has something for everyone from the Great Smoky Mountains National Park, the Memphis Zoo, the Country Music Hall of Fame, and the Jack Daniel's Distillery. Tennessee is also home to respected institutions such as Vanderbilt University and the University of Tennessee. In addition, Tennessee's economy is also thriving, driven by a mix of industries, including healthcare, finance, and manufacturing.

For adventure seekers, there is plenty to do in Tennessee, from fishing in the Tennessee River to hiking in the Smoky Mountains. Sports fans can cheer on the Tennessee Titans (NFL), Nashville Predators (NHL), and Memphis Grizzlies (NBA). Discover and indulge in famous attractions like the Ryman Auditorium, the Parthenon, and Graceland. The state is also known for its rich music history, including blues, country, and rock-and-roll, and there is a thriving theater and arts scene in cities like Nashville and Memphis.

Its high quality of life, strong economy, and friendly community make Tennessee a great place to call home.

Rental Market Trends

Hamilton County, TN

As of July 2026, Hamilton County's rental market is competitive, with strong renter demand causing quick leasing times for well-priced units. Hamilton County's average rent is 6.8% ($95) lower than the Tennessee average of $1,406 and 26.8% ($481) lower than the U.S. average of $1,792.

Frequently Asked Questions
Hamilton County Rental Market FAQs

Explore rental prices, market trends, and availability in Hamilton County, TN.

The average rent in Hamilton County, TN is $1,311 per month.
Homes in Hamilton County typically rent for between $841 and $2,220 per month, with an average of $1,311 per month.
In Hamilton County, the average rent for a 1-bedroom home is $1,202 per month, for a 2-bedroom home, $1,376 per month, and a 3-bedroom home is $1,708 per month.
The average rent in Hamilton County is 26.8% ($481) lower than the national average of $1,792 per month.
The average rent in Hamilton County has decreased by 0.2% ($3) in the last month and decreased by 10.5% ($153) over the past year.
The rental market in Hamilton County, TN, is currently competitive, with strong renter demand causing quick leasing times for well-priced units.
In Hamilton County, TN, the average rental stays on the market for approximately 29 days. While most properties are rented within this timeframe, factors like seasonality, demand, and property type can affect how quickly a rental leases.
There are currently 386 rental properties available in Hamilton County, TN.
Based on the current averages, a household would need an annual income of $55,040 to comfortably afford a 2-bedroom home in Hamilton County.
